Text: |
ФІО = Семенець Наталія
Запитання:Описати масив,першы елементи выдповыдно мають значення 1 ы 2, а ыншы заповнити сумою попередных елементыв
====================================
ANSWER ====================================
using System;
using System.Collections.Generic;
using System.Text;
namespace ConsoleApplication1
{
class Program
{
const int max = 10;
static double[] mas = new double[max];
static void zapolnit_masiv()
{
for (int i = 0; i < 2; i++) // цикл заполняет два первых елемента 1 и 2 и выводит на екран
{
mas[i] = i+1;
Console.WriteLine("mas[{0}] = {1}", i, mas[i]);
}
for (int i = 2; i < max; i++) // цикл заполняет до конца весь масив строго по заданию и выводит.
{// начинает заполнение с трейтего елемента массива.
mas[i] = 0; // очищаем текущую ячейку, с даными
for (int j = 0; j < i; j++) // эта функция заполняет текущую ячейку, суммой предыдущих значений елементов
{
mas[i] += mas[j];
}
Console.WriteLine("mas[{0}] = {1}", i,mas[i]);// вывод значения текущей ячейки
}
}
static void Main(string[] args)
{
zapolnit_masiv();
Console.ReadKey();
}
}
}
END of ANSWER ====================================
|